The essay argues that as the web evolves toward a decentralized, AI-driven Web 3.0, data integrity must become the dominant security priority, surpassing the availability emphasis of Web 1.0 and the confidentiality focus of Web 2.0. It outlines a layered approach to integrity—from hardware and filesystems through ML frameworks to user interfaces—highlighting risks of biased, corrupted, or unverifiable AI outputs without robust controls. The authors call for granular access, advanced authentication, transparent data ownership, and standardized access, leveraging open W3C protocols (DIDs, verifiable credentials, ActivityPub, Solid, WebAuthn) to ensure provenance and trust. They conclude that integrity-focused standards should become foundational, akin to how HTTPS underpins today’s trusted web services.
